Musopen
,----[ Quote ]
| This site takes music that is in the public domain, meaning a work that
| belongs to the community, and has it recorded by individuals and
| college/community orchestras throughout the United States and stored online
| so it can be accessed for free through this website.
`----
http://www.musopen.com/
There are more sites like this. It seems like a hot trend that results in free
distribution of music and new revenue models (e.g. concerts, added value,
exclusive music, guitar lessons).

Music industry attacks Sunday newspaper's free Prince CD
.----
| The eagerly awaited new album by Prince is being launched as a free
| CD with a national Sunday newspaper in a move that has drawn
| widespread criticism from music retailers.
|
| [...]
|
| The Entertainment Retailers Association said the giveaway "beggars
| belief". "It would be an insult to all those record stores who have
| supported Prince throughout his career," ERA co-chairman Paul Quirk
| told a music conference. "It would be yet another example of the
| damaging covermount culture which is destroying any perception of
| value around recorded music.
`----
